The Duty of Sugar Cane in Biofuels



As nations seek sustainable power sources, sugar Cane has become a crucial gamer in the biofuels field. This tropical plant is abundant in sucrose, which can be fermented to produce ethanol, a renewable fuel option to nonrenewable fuel sources. The growing of sugar Cane for biofuel manufacturing not just reduces greenhouse gas emissions however likewise adds to power safety, specifically in sugar-producing nations.


In addition, sugar cane-derived ethanol can be mixed with gasoline, boosting its octane ranking and minimizing reliance on non-renewable resources. The results of sugar Cane processing, such as bagasse, are valuable for producing power, making the whole manufacturing cycle energy-efficient.


Research study continues to check out advanced approaches for taking full advantage of energy return from sugar walking cane, solidifying its role in the shift to cleaner power options. As international demand for sustainable gas rises, sugar Cane stands out as an important element of the biofuel industry.


Sugar Cane as a Source of Bioplastics



The ecological influences of plastic air pollution are progressively concerning, sugar Cane uses an appealing alternative as a source of bioplastics. Originated from renewable energies, bioplastics made from sugar Cane can substantially reduce dependence on petroleum-based plastics. These bioplastics are produced through the fermentation of sugars drawn out from the walking cane, causing products that can be compostable or eco-friendly, depending on their formula.


Making use of sugar Cane bioplastics not just decreases carbon discharges but additionally promotes lasting agricultural practices. By utilizing agricultural waste and by-products, the total environmental impact of manufacturing is lessened. In addition, items made from sugar Cane bioplastics can perfectly incorporate into existing waste monitoring systems, attending to concerns concerning waste accumulation.


As industries seek lasting remedies, sugar cane-based bioplastics stand for a practical option that straightens with worldwide initiatives to combat plastic contamination and cultivate a round economic situation.

Nutritional Conveniences and Pet Feed

Sugar Cane acts as an important source of nourishment in pet feed, offering a number of benefits for livestock. Rich in carbohydrates, particularly sugars, it gives a high-energy diet plan important for growth and efficiency. The fibrous results of sugar cane, such as bagasse, contribute to nutritional fiber, promoting healthy digestion in ruminants like cattle and lamb. This coarse material help in preventing digestion problems and supports overall intestine health.


Furthermore, sugar Cane contains vital minerals and vitamins that enhance the dietary account of pet feed, boosting immunity and general well-being. Its wonderful preference and palatability make it an enticing feed alternative, encouraging feed consumption amongst pets. By integrating sugar Cane right into their diet plans, livestock manufacturers can minimize reliance on conventional feed sources, possibly decreasing feed prices while preserving pet health and wellness and productivity. Sugar Cane emerges as a nourishing and sustainable alternative in the area of pet farming.

Can Sugar Cane Be Expanded in Any Environment?





Sugar Cane thrives in subtropical and exotic environments, requiring warm temperatures, enough sunlight, and sufficient rainfall. Its growth is limited in colder regions, making it inappropriate for temperate or frozen climates where frost happens.
